Karya, built on 2020-11-26T21:03:17 (patch 23b5be2d53a9e8e7d6136cda5aae2849abe5cded)
Safe HaskellNone

Solkattu.Instrument.Reyong

Contents

Description

Realize abstract solkattu Notes to concrete reyong Notes.

Synopsis

Documentation

data Stroke Source #

Constructors

N1 
N2 
N3 
N4 
N14 
Byut 
Byong 
CekC 
CekO 

Instances

Instances details
Eq Stroke # 
Instance details

Defined in Solkattu.Instrument.Reyong

Methods

(==) :: Stroke -> Stroke -> Bool #

(/=) :: Stroke -> Stroke -> Bool #

Ord Stroke # 
Instance details

Defined in Solkattu.Instrument.Reyong

Show Stroke # 
Instance details

Defined in Solkattu.Instrument.Reyong

Pretty Stroke # 
Instance details

Defined in Solkattu.Instrument.Reyong

Expr.ToExpr Stroke # 
Instance details

Defined in Solkattu.Instrument.Reyong

Solkattu.Notation Stroke # 
Instance details

Defined in Solkattu.Instrument.Reyong

Expr.ToExpr (Realize.Stroke Stroke) # 
Instance details

Defined in Solkattu.Instrument.Reyong

data Strokes a Source #

Constructors

Strokes 

Fields

  • r1 :: a
     
  • r2 :: a
     
  • r3 :: a
     
  • r4 :: a
     
  • i :: a
     
  • b :: a
     
  • o :: a
     
  • k :: a
     
  • x :: a
     

Instances

Instances details
Functor Strokes # 
Instance details

Defined in Solkattu.Instrument.Reyong

Methods

fmap :: (a -> b) -> Strokes a -> Strokes b #

(<$) :: a -> Strokes b -> Strokes a #

Show a => Show (Strokes a) # 
Instance details

Defined in Solkattu.Instrument.Reyong

Methods

showsPrec :: Int -> Strokes a -> ShowS #

show :: Strokes a -> String #

showList :: [Strokes a] -> ShowS #

patterns